About

Exports In 2022, Sri Lanka exported $52.3k in Scrap Waste, making it the 106th largest exporter of Scrap Waste in the world. At the same year, Scrap Waste was the 722nd most exported product in Sri Lanka. The main destination of Scrap Waste exports from Sri Lanka are: United Arab Emirates ($36.1k) and Malaysia ($16.2k).

The fastest growing export markets for Scrap Waste of Sri Lanka between 2021 and 2022 were United Arab Emirates ($36.1k) and Malaysia ($16.2k).

Imports In 2018, Sri Lanka imported $5.87M in Scrap Waste, becoming the 21st largest importer of Scrap Waste in the world. At the same year, Scrap Waste was the 345th most imported product in Sri Lanka. Sri Lanka imports Scrap Waste primarily from: United States ($1.13M), United Arab Emirates ($1.03M), Belgium ($991k), Chinese Taipei ($623k), and France ($572k).

The fastest growing import markets in Scrap Waste for Sri Lanka between 2021 and 2022 were United States ($696k), United Arab Emirates ($667k), and Pakistan ($359k).
